WebKnow the Lingo About Blood Clots. Deep vein thrombosis (DVT): Blood clot located in a deep vein, usually in a leg or arm. Pulmonary embolism (PE): Blood clot that has traveled from a deep vein to a lung. DVT and … hcareers california

March is Blood Clot Awareness Month (BCAM), which provides a crucial opportunity to share life-saving information about blood clots on a larger and more far-reaching scale. Blood clots affect as many as 900,000 Americans each year. And complications from blood clots kill one person every six minutes in the United States.

The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) estimated in 2010 that 900,000 Americans experienced a deep vein thrombosis (DVT) or pulmonary embolism (PE) type of blood clot each year. That’s more than the annual number of heart attacks or strokes.
